Remembering a friend

Durward Swanson, Dec. 7, 1941, Hickam Field survivor, visit the resting place of George Smith at the National Memorial Cemetery of the Pacific, or Punchbowl National Cemetery, Nov. 22 during his visit to Hawaii. Swanson visited the base where 70 years ago he survived the sudden attack by the Japanese on Dec. 7, 1941. His friend Smith was killed during the attacks on Hickam Field.
